MiniBio

The young men’s center forward first made headlines when he was signed by the River Plate Athletic Club as a teenager back in 2018. Before that, though, his journey began with the Instituto youth squad, where he showcased early promise on the field. He caught the attention of bigger clubs and joined River Plate in 2016, laying the foundation for what would become a rising professional career. The men’s center forward spent a few formative years there before being loaned to Colón Athletic Club in 2021, gaining valuable experience and exposure at a higher level. By 2023, his talent had drawn international interest, leading him to begin playing for Fiorentina—an exciting new chapter in his development. Growing up in Córdoba, Argentina, the men’s center forward lived with his family and was one of four siblings, balancing the demands of youth soccer with everyday life. His roots in Córdoba helped shape his determination and work ethic, both key traits that have defined the men’s center forward’s path so far.

Trivia

He made his professional club debut with River Plate in a match against Gimnasia y Esgrima LP on December 2, 2018. At just 17 years old, he stepped onto the field for the first time as a pro, marking a significant milestone in his young career. His performance that day was impressive, especially considering his age, and it quickly became clear that he had what it takes to compete at the highest level. Since then, he has continued to grow, showing steady improvement and earning more opportunities with River Plate. His journey from that debut moment has been closely watched by fans and scouts alike, all eager to see how far he can go.
